About Abacoa
Abacoa is a 2,055-acre master-planned, mixed-use community in Jupiter built on traditional-neighborhood principles, with more than 4,000 homes, a walkable town center, and Roger Dean Chevrolet Stadium. It offers single-family homes, townhomes, condos, and apartments along tree-lined streets with front porches and alley garages. A golf club, community park, and a 260-acre greenway add to its family-friendly, walkable appeal.
Abacoa is a large master-planned community in Jupiter, and as a planned development it offers more variety than a single gated neighborhood. Within its boundaries you will find single-family homes, townhomes, and condominiums across a range of villages and price points, along with a town-center area that blends residential with retail and dining. Pricing is broad as a result, spanning attainable townhomes and condos up to larger single-family homes, which makes the community accessible to first-time buyers, families, and professionals alike. The walkable, mixed-use design sets it apart from the more typical gated, car-only communities in the area.
The location is one of Abacoa's strengths. Jupiter places it near the northern Palm Beach County coast, with beaches, the Intracoastal, and the Loxahatchee River within a short drive, and I-95 and Florida's Turnpike close for travel south toward West Palm Beach or north toward the Treasure Coast. The community's town center and the surrounding Jupiter and Palm Beach Gardens corridors provide extensive shopping, dining, and medical care, and the area is known for its parks and outdoor recreation. Families often weigh school assignments here, so confirming current boundaries with the district is worthwhile.
Because Abacoa contains many distinct neighborhoods, HOA structures and fees vary widely from village to village, and some sections carry community development district assessments, so buyers should confirm exactly what applies to a given home. South Florida insurance still factors in: even a few miles inland, windstorm coverage, roof condition, impact openings, and flood zone status affect premiums. Abacoa suits buyers who want a walkable, amenity-rich planned community with options at multiple price points, value proximity to Jupiter's beaches and town life, and appreciate a range of home types within one cohesive development.

Buying in Abacoa
Buying in Abacoa follows the same path as the rest of Palm Beach County. Getting a mortgage pre-approval first tells you your real budget and lets you move quickly when the right home comes up. Property taxes factor into the monthly payment: the median annual property tax in Palm Beach County is about $3,600. Florida's homestead exemption lowers the taxable value of a primary residence, and the Save Our Homes cap limits how fast that assessed value can rise from year to year. Budget for homeowners insurance as well. Rates in Florida reflect wind and flood exposure, so gather quotes early and check whether a specific address sits in a FEMA flood zone. Once you are under contract, plan for a home inspection and, if you are financing, a lender appraisal, both of which fall inside the inspection period. Selling in Abacoa
A successful sale in Abacoa comes down to pricing, presentation, and marketing. List prices in Abacoa currently center around $534,900, which is a starting reference for where a comparable home might be positioned. Homes that are decluttered, professionally photographed, and priced to recent comparable sales tend to draw the most interest in the first two weeks, when a listing is newest and gets the most views. Florida sellers usually pay the documentary stamp tax on the deed, currently $0.70 per $100 of the sale price in most counties, along with prorated property taxes and, by local custom in many areas, the owner's title insurance policy.
